adidas Readies the NMD S1 for Summertime

A “Cream White” base invites an assortment of colors to join it.

In its ninth year on the market, the adidas NMD series is still going strong. Recently, the Three Stripes tapped Japanese streetwear label NEIGHBORHOOD for a collaboration on the NMD S1 and a unique boot version of the silhouette while also ushering in another iteration of the shoe — the NMD W1. While the design may not hold the same power it once did, there’s no denying it plays a key role in adidas Originals’ lifestyle offerings each year.

Now, as the NMD S1 continues to shine, adidas has prepared a new summertime-ready colorway. Kicking things off, the shoe starts with a knit upper containing yearn with at least 50% Parley Ocean Plastic and 50% recycled polyester. This knit primarily carries the colorway’s leading “Cream White” hue — a soft off-white that is joined by hits of red around the collar and at the Three Stripes. The midfoot looks to reveal the shoe’s interior with the aforementioned “Cream White” and a crisp green joining red at the Three Stripes on each side. Supporting the sneaker, a matching off-white midsole carries blue TPU plugs and is backed by a gum rubber outsole to complete this look.

Adding to adidas’ releases scheduled for July 1, this NMD S1 colorway is set to launch at 3am EDT via adidas and select retailers at a price of $200 USD on July 1.
